拥有数据字典的数据库是什么
-
拥有数据字典的数据库是指在数据库系统中,可以通过数据字典来管理和维护数据库的元数据信息的数据库。
-
数据字典是什么:数据字典是数据库中存储和管理元数据信息的一个重要组成部分。它包含了数据库中的表、列、索引、约束、触发器等对象的定义和描述信息,以及它们之间的关系和依赖关系。
-
数据字典的作用:数据字典为数据库管理员、开发人员和用户提供了一个统一的管理和查询接口,可以帮助他们更好地理解和使用数据库。通过数据字典,用户可以查看表的结构、列的数据类型、约束条件等信息,从而更好地理解数据库中存储的数据。
-
数据字典的组成:一个完整的数据字典通常包含了以下几个方面的信息:表名、列名、数据类型、长度、索引、约束、触发器、视图、存储过程等。这些信息可以通过数据库系统的系统表或者视图来获取和维护。
-
数据字典的优势:拥有数据字典的数据库可以提供更好的数据管理和维护能力。通过数据字典,可以方便地查找和修改数据库中的对象定义,减少人为错误的发生。此外,数据字典还可以帮助数据库管理员进行性能优化,通过查看索引和约束信息,以及分析表之间的依赖关系,来提高数据库的查询性能。
-
数据字典的应用场景:数据字典广泛应用于数据库开发、数据库维护和数据分析等领域。在数据库开发中,数据字典可以帮助开发人员更好地理解和使用数据库,减少开发周期。在数据库维护中,数据字典可以帮助管理员快速定位和修复问题。在数据分析中,数据字典可以帮助分析师了解数据的结构和含义,从而更好地进行数据分析和决策。
总结:拥有数据字典的数据库可以提供更好的数据管理和维护能力,通过数据字典,可以方便地查找和修改数据库中的对象定义,减少人为错误的发生。数据字典还可以帮助数据库管理员进行性能优化,提高数据库的查询性能。数据字典在数据库开发、维护和数据分析等领域都有广泛的应用。
1年前 -
-
拥有数据字典的数据库是指数据库管理系统(Database Management System,简称DBMS)中具备数据字典功能的数据库。
数据库是用于存储和管理数据的系统,而数据库管理系统是用来管理数据库的软件。数据字典是数据库管理系统中的一个重要组成部分,它记录了数据库中存储的数据的结构、属性和关系等信息。
数据字典包含了数据库中所有的表、字段、索引、视图、触发器等对象的定义和属性信息。它是一个元数据的集合,用于描述数据库中的各个元素及其关系。数据字典可以作为数据库管理员、开发人员和用户之间的沟通桥梁,可以帮助用户更好地理解和使用数据库。
拥有数据字典的数据库具有以下几个特点:
-
数据库结构清晰:通过数据字典,可以清楚地了解数据库中的表、字段、索引等对象的定义和属性信息,使数据库的结构更加清晰明了。
-
数据库维护方便:在数据库中使用数据字典可以方便地对数据库进行维护和管理。例如,可以通过数据字典来查找和修改数据库中的对象定义,快速定位和解决问题。
-
数据库开发高效:在数据库开发过程中,可以利用数据字典来快速生成数据库的文档和报表,减少了开发人员的工作量,并提高了开发效率。
-
数据库使用便捷:对于数据库的用户来说,通过数据字典可以更好地了解数据库中的数据结构和属性,从而更方便地进行数据查询和操作。
总之,拥有数据字典的数据库能够提供更好的数据管理和使用体验,使数据库的设计、开发和维护工作更加高效和便捷。
1年前 -
-
拥有数据字典的数据库是指在数据库管理系统中,可以创建和管理数据字典的数据库。数据字典是一个包含了数据库中所有表、列、索引、触发器等对象的详细描述信息的集合。它记录了数据库中的每个对象的定义、结构、属性以及其他相关信息。拥有数据字典可以帮助数据库管理员和开发人员更好地理解和管理数据库,提供了对数据库结构和数据的详细了解。
在拥有数据字典的数据库中,通常会有以下操作流程:
-
创建数据字典表:首先,需要创建一个用于存储数据字典的表。这个表可以包含列如表名、列名、数据类型、长度、约束条件等字段,用于记录数据库对象的详细信息。
-
手动记录数据字典信息:在创建数据字典表之后,可以手动记录数据库中每个对象的信息。这包括数据库表、列、索引、触发器等的定义和属性信息。可以通过查询系统表或使用数据库管理工具来获取这些信息,并将其记录到数据字典表中。
-
自动化记录数据字典信息:为了减少手动记录的工作量,可以使用数据库管理工具或脚本来自动记录数据字典信息。这些工具可以通过系统表或元数据API来提取数据库对象的信息,并将其写入数据字典表中。
-
更新数据字典信息:数据库中的对象可能会发生变化,例如添加、修改或删除表、列等。因此,需要定期更新数据字典信息,以保持其与实际数据库结构的一致性。可以通过手动更新或使用自动化工具来实现。
-
查询和使用数据字典:一旦数据字典信息被记录和更新,就可以使用它来查询数据库对象的定义和属性。可以使用查询语句或数据库管理工具来检索所需的信息,以便更好地理解和管理数据库。
总之,拥有数据字典的数据库可以提供对数据库结构和数据的详细了解,帮助数据库管理员和开发人员更好地管理和维护数据库。通过创建数据字典表、手动或自动记录信息、更新数据字典信息以及查询和使用数据字典,可以有效地管理数据库。
1年前 -